Actor Arjun Kapoor, who is working with her childhood friend Sonakshi Sinha for the first time in Tevar, says he didn’t imagine her being an actress.
Sonakshi and Arjun are childhood friends and co-incidentally both were fat kids. When asked Arjun whether he ever thought that she would become an actor, he said, “I didn’t imagine her being actress but after a certain time I figured out that she does. Later, I came to know that she wanted to be an actress. If I can become an actor then anybody can become one. If I can do what I did somebody like her, who has tremendous will power, could manage to achieve even before me.”
“She was always an attractive girl when she was in school… just before Dabangg started I had met her and she had lost tremendous weight and she was looking very good. It makes complete sense that she became an actress,” he added.
Arjun has also paid tribute to his mentor Salman Khan in Tevar with a song. Talking about the same, he said, “These things happen in other films too. Even in Haider there were two characters whose names were Salman, so it won’t be the first, it won’t be the last. He is the iconic personality and any kid growing up in any part of India today is influenced by Salman Khan as a person and Salman Khan as a star.”
Directed by Amit Sharma, Tevar features Arjun Kapoor, Sonakshi Sinha, Manoj Bajpai among others.
